Notts County manager Keith Curle is in no rush to add more new faces to his squad ahead of the forthcoming League One campaign.
Curle has signed eight players this summer but has expressed a desire to bring in two or three further targets.
Trialists mixed in with the contracted squad members during the opening week of pre-season and Curle is keeping a close eye on them in the build-up to Saturday's friendly with Buxton.
The Magpies boss is happy to play the waiting game so that he can secure the best available talent.
"If there was no room to bring anybody in I wouldn't waste their time. I won't have anybody hanging around the football club who I don't think warrants or merits being here," Curle told the club's official website. "But the door is always open and there's still money available in the budget to bring in further players. There's other avenues that are available to us as well, it's not always free transfers.
"There might be younger players at football clubs under contract that might need the experience to come out, some people are older players that have still got a year left on their contract that don't fit in at Championship and Premier League teams' plans. They might not be available to us as well but they might nearer to the start of the season because they will be trying to impress their managers to say they are part of the squads."
